Javaの標準APIでHTTP接続を行う場合、Java 8以前のバージョンでは、HttpURLConnectionクラスを利用する方法が一般的だった。しかし、このクラスはJava SE 1.1の頃(1996年)に追加された非常に古いもので、機能面でも使い勝手の面でも、現在のアプリケーション開発で ...
前回は、Java 11から正式に追加されたHTTPクライアントAPIを使った基本的なHTTP通信のやり方を解説した。 今回も引き続き、いろいろなバリエーションのHTTP通信のやり方を解説する。 前回は、レスポンスボディはHttpResponseインスタンスに対してbody()メソッドを ...
翔泳社では、「独習」「徹底入門」「スラスラわかる」「絵で見てわかる」「一年生」などの人気シリーズをはじめ、言語や開発手法、最新技術を解説した書籍を多数手がけています。プロジェクトマネジメントやチームビルティングといった管理職向けの ...
ブラウザーは、URLをアドレスバーに入力することでWEBページを表示します。今回は、http://example.com/page01.htmlというURLを使っ ...
Apache JMeter(ジェイメーター)は、WebアプリケーションやAPIなどのパフォーマンステストを行うためのオープンソースツールです。 HTTPリクエストやデータベースクエリの負荷テスト、応答時間の測定、同時アクセスのシミュレーションなどをGUIベースで設定 ...
サービスが使えない状況があってはいけない 近年、 私たちは有料無料を問わず、 さまざまなサービスを利用できます。外出するときには地図で目的地を確認し、 公共交通機関の経路を検索するか、 車で通る経路を検索するのではないでしょうか。公共 ...
Java 18's Simple Web Server lets you use a command-line tool or API to host files and more. Here's how it works. One of the handiest new features included in the Java 18 release (March 2022) was the ...
具体的には(1)リクエストメッセージ(HTTPリクエスト)と対になるレスポンスメッセージ(HTTPレスポンス)で構成される(図2-2)、(2)メッセージは大きく3つのパート(リクエスト行やステータス行によるメッセージの識別部、メッセージヘッダー、メッセージボディー)に分かれている、(3)それぞれのリクエストとレスポンスは独立しており、セッション情報 ...
一部の結果でアクセス不可の可能性があるため、非表示になっています。
アクセス不可の結果を表示する